## Authentication

The Cartwheel load-test harness replays synthetic checkout sessions against the Bramblegate staging cluster. Reviewers verifying a run should note that every virtual user authenticates through the Keyline token service rather than the production identity provider, so test traffic never touches real accounts. Rate limits are relaxed for the load-test credential, which is scoped to staging only and rotates weekly. The credential currently in effect is listed below.

service key, fawip-bajef: kto11_Qt5wZK9vdNC

## Add audit-log viewer pagination

Hey reviewer! This PR adds the long-requested audit-log viewer to the Tallowgate admin console. It renders events from the Pinwheel ledger service with cursor-based pagination, so no more loading 50k rows into the browser and watching it cry. Filtering by actor and event type works now, and the export button streams CSV instead of buffering. I also pulled the retry and page-size knobs out of the component so ops can tweak them without a redeploy. The tuning constants are below.

tuning constants:
QUOTAS = {
    "druwyn": 5,
    "holix": 5,
    "zorath": 5,
    "holwyn": 10,
}

Team,

The Kestrel Partner Programme launches next quarter across all branches. Tiering: Silver at 10% margin, Gold at 15% with co-op funds. Onboarding handled centrally; branch managers own local recruitment targets — minimum four signed resellers per territory by quarter end. Training packs ship next week. Do not discuss terms with prospects until contracts are countersigned by Legal. Fenwick will circulate the pipeline tracker Monday. The strategic rationale for the programme is set out below for managers only.

confidential, faduf-kafof: The steering committee signed off on a budget of $300.1 million for Project Holeth.

Welcome to the Lanternfall decomposition effort. We are extracting the user module from the Orchardview monolith into a standalone service called Bellhop. Please read the strangler-pattern notes carefully before touching shared session tables, as both systems write to them during the transition. Local development requires the Bellhop identity shim, which proxies auth calls back to the monolith. Configure the shim with the internal key provided below.

app token of badug-tahaf = qvz11-nP5FBNr8qnh